Skip to content

elementos de scripting

los elementos de scripting son etiquetas que utilizamos para usar otros lenguajes como CSS y JavaScript

etiqueta style

esta etiqueta cuya función es para utilizar el lenguaje CSS es decir podemos estilizar los estilos a nuestra pagina web mas info visita la guia de CSS.

html
<style>
  p {
    color: red;
  }
</style>
<style>
  p {
    color: red;
  }
</style>
AtributosDescripción
typesirve para especificar el formato es opcional debido que por valor predeterminado es text/css
mediaeste atributo sirve para especificar el media query del estilo CSS

esta etiqueta solo la recomiendo si trabajas con un solo archivo HTML o si usas webcomponents no es recomendable si es igual o superior a dos archivos HTML se debe emplear el uso de la etiqueta link

etiqueta script

esta etiqueta se utilizar para escribir JavaScript dentro de html o llamar archivo JavaScript mas info visite la guia de javascript

html
<!-- llamado un archivo externo de javascript -->
<script src="javascript.js"></script>

<!-- escribiendo javascript -->
<script>
  alert("Hello World!");
</script>
<!-- llamado un archivo externo de javascript -->
<script src="javascript.js"></script>

<!-- escribiendo javascript -->
<script>
  alert("Hello World!");
</script>
AtributosDescripción
asyncatributo booleano sirve para cargar el JavaScript de forma asíncrona
deferatributo booleano sirve para retrasar la carga de JavaScript es decir el JavaScript se carga después de finalizar la carga del documento HTML
nomodulees para indicar que este documento no puede ejecutar los es modules "módulos de EcmaScript" para indicar que esta pagina no es compatible con la versiones de es6+
srcsirve para traer la ruta del archivo JavaScript
typeantes es usando para el type text/javascript ahora se usar para el un nuevo valor module para traer los módulos de EcmaScript
languagesirve para traer otros lenguajes de programación ahora es un atributo desfasado
charsetsirve para asignar una codificación de caracteres actualmente es un atributo desfasado

es recomendable para el uso de JavaScript externo si trabajas con múltiples documentos HTML pero si es un solo documento HTML si es recomendable usarlo solo en casos muy concretos

lanzado bajo la licencia CC-BY-NC-SA